Quantex to Incorporate Intel Pentium III Xeon Processors Into Workstations and Servers

Business Wire, March 17, 1999

SOMERSET, N.J.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--March 17, 1999--Quantex Microsystems, Inc., a leading manufacturer of computer systems in the direct channel, today announced the availability of new systems based on the Intel 500MHz and 550MHz Pentium(R) III Xeon(tm) processors.

These new processors are featured in the Quantex ZXi-Series Workstations and the Quantex QX-Series Servers and are available with 512KB, 1MB and 2MB of cache.

The Pentium III Xeon processor delivers optimum efficiency and pure power from its unified Level 2 cache, 100-MHz system bus and highly scalable multiprocessing support for mid-range and high-end servers. The processor contains Streaming SIMD Extensions, 70 new instructions for improved TCP/IP and memory/cache performance, and to significantly boost the speed and performance of media rich and memory intensive applications. It also contains a variety of advanced management features, including Error Checking and Correction for data protection and the assignment of a processor number for system identification.

The Intel Pentium III Xeon processor is now available in ZXi Workstation, creating for the highest performing multiprocessor-capable workstation ever available from Quantex. These workstations feature high-end 2D, 3D and OpenGL support for graphics-intensive CAD/CAM applications, electronic design automation (EDA), digital content creation (DCC), financial modeling and software engineering. Additionally, these Quantex systems are sold as a standard network-ready solution, including industry standard initiatives such as wired for management (WFM), DMI 2.0, ACPI and QSentry Technology, Quantex' network management and PC health monitoring software.

Quantex QX-Series Servers are custom-configured and feature the Intel Pentium III Xeon processor in two-way and four-way configurations to deliver enterprise-class performance in a high-end server platform. In addition to true multi-processing power, these servers are RAID-ready, and have advanced management features like a built-in Emergency Management Port and Intel Server Control for maximum security, performance and scalability.
